Security Deposit

For AY 25-26:

1. The property takes GBP 150 which is non-refundable after 48 hours.

2. This is to secure the room initially and will be held in DPS and returned to you at the end of tenancy if deemed appropriate.

Pay In Instalment

The property offers 3 payment options:

1. Pay in full.

2. Pay in termly instalments.

3. Pay in monthly (requires a UK based guarantor).

Mode Of Payment

Credit card, debit card and bank transfer.

Guarantor Requirement

For AY 25-26:

1. The property requires you to have a valid UK based guarantor, if you would like to pay in monthly instalments, at the time of booking.

2. If you wish to pay in termly installments, the property requires an international or UK guarantor.

3. If you pay in full, the property does not require a guarantor.

Additional Fees

Dual Occupancy Charges: Additional 10% per week.

Cooling Off Period

For AY 25-26:

1. For bookings made until May 31, 2025, a 5-day cooling off period allows cancellations without charges, providing flexibility and financial protection for unexpected changes in plans.

2. For bookings made after May 31, 2025, the cooling off period is reduced to 48 hours, allowing some time for changes without financial consequences.

3. Ensure to notify the resident's team via e-mail within the cooling off period to take advantage of this policy.

Note: Once you have booked and the cooling off period has passed, you are bound by a legal license agreement that requires you to pay for the entire duration of the license agreement.

No Visa No Pay

For AY 25-26:

1. The "No Visa, No Pay" policy for international students offers a refund if their UK visa application is rejected by UKVI.

2. To be eligible for a full refund, students must notify the property provider before August 1, 2025. This policy eases the financial burden for students whose visa applications are rejected through no fault of their own.

3. Students who fail to complete necessary steps for the UK visa application or do not obtain a Confirmation of Acceptance for Studies (CAS) number due to failing university application requirements are ineligible for a refund under this policy.

4. Adhering to visa guidelines and completing all application steps is crucial for students applying for a visa and utilizing the "No Visa, No Pay" policy.

Note:

To cancel accommodation, tenants must notify the property team in writing within 48 hours of any changes that necessitate cancellation, providing valid proof (e.g., visa denials). The property team may request additional documentation to verify the cancellation reason.

Cost of Living

The average cost of living for students in Liverpool is approximately 23% cheaper than in London, with students usually spending £750 - £1,100 per month, depending on lifestyle. Here's a breakdown of typical monthly expenses to help plan your budget, excluding rent for your luxury student homes Liverpool:

1. Food and eatery: £150 to £270 monthly.

2. Travelling expenses: ( Public transport ) £40 and £70 monthly.

3. Leisure and entertainment:  £50 to £130 monthly.

4. Stationery and textbooks: £80 to £100 per month

5. Internet & mobile phone: £50 to £80 per month

6. Average rent: £140 to £170 per month

Student Travel in Liverpool

Transport in Liverpool is easy and inexpensive, meaning that students can discover this wonderful city and travel between their homes and other locations easily. Liverpool has a variety of transport options that meet your budget and preferences. The closest airport is John Lennon Airport in Liverpool. Some of the best modes of transport available for students include:

ModeRoutes CoveredStudent Cost
Arriva Bus (UniRider)All Arriva services across Liverpool City Region£193 (Term 1) / £487 (Full Year)
Stagecoach Bus (UniRider)All Stagecoach services in Merseyside & Chester£165 (Term 1) / £399 (Annual)
Merseyrail (Railpass)Selected zones (Northern, Wirral, & City lines)~£96 – £198 (Per Term depending on zones)
Trio TicketCombined Bus, Train, and Ferry (All Merseyside)£110 – £225 (Per Term depending on zones)
Bolt E-Scooters / BikesCity-wide (including Speke/Garston)£1 unlock fee + ~£0.20/min (Student discounts via app)
Mersey FerryCross-river (Liverpool Seacombe/Woodside)£11.50 (Sightseeing) / £4 (Commuter Return)
Walking / CyclingKnowledge Quarter, City Center, & ParksFree (Bike hire from Student Guild: £40–£60/year)
